The benefits of slow living in a fast-paced world

In today’s high-speed, hyper-connected world, we’re often encouraged to do more, achieve more, and consume more. However, an antidote to this overwhelming lifestyle has emerged: slow living. At its core, slow living emphasizes intentionality, mindfulness, and sustainability. It’s about valuing quality over quantity and finding joy in the simple, meaningful aspects of life.

What is slow living?

Slow living is not about doing everything at a snail’s pace—it’s about consciously choosing to focus on what brings you fulfillment. This lifestyle aligns perfectly with the principles of slow fashion: embracing quality, ethical production, and timeless design over fleeting trends.

The connection between slow living and slow fashion

  • Intentional choices: both slow living and slow fashion encourage thoughtful decision-making. When you purchase a handcrafted garment, you’re investing in a piece that tells a story and holds lasting value.
  • Sustainability: slow living champions eco-conscious practices, from reducing waste to supporting sustainable brands. Slow fashion embodies this by using natural, high-quality materials that are kind to the planet.
  • Mindfulness: in the rush of life, taking time to appreciate the artistry behind a handmade item or savoring a calm moment can make a significant difference in your overall well-being.

Practical steps to embrace slow living

  1. Declutter your life: start by removing distractions and focusing on meaningful experiences over material possessions.
  2. Choose quality over quantity: whether it’s your wardrobe, food, or relationships, prioritize things that enrich your life.
  3. Support ethical brands: opt for businesses that align with your values, such as those offering artisanal, sustainable, and thoughtfully crafted products.
  4. Savor daily moments: take time to enjoy life’s simple pleasures—a walk in nature, a cup of tea, or the feel of a well-made sweater.

Why it matters

Adopting slow living isn’t just a trend—it’s a mindset that can transform your well-being and the planet’s health. By slowing down and making mindful choices, we create a ripple effect that inspires a more thoughtful, sustainable world.
